    Reimagining Hospitality from the Ground Up with Ryan Wagner

    Hospitality is often described as an industry. But for Ryan Wagner, it's always been a discipline. One that's shaped by curiosity, precision, and the ability to make people feel anchored in a moment. This week, we spotlight Ryan's journey through some of the most influential corners of the hospitality world. His career has taken him from the design‑driven environments of Ralph Lauren and RH to the high‑touch, detail‑obsessed culture of Hogsalt Hospitality. In New York, he played a key role on the opening team of 4 Charles Prime Rib, a dining room that quickly became synonymous with warmth, exclusivity, and impeccable execution. But Ryan’s story isn’t defined by the logos on his résumé. It’s defined by the through‑line that connects them: an unwavering belief that hospitality begins long before a guest arrives and continues long after they leave. The ability to read a room, anticipate a need, and create a sense of belonging is not a tactic, but a craft. Said craft is exactly what Ryan has carried into his next chapter, as the founder of Off Map Glamping. What began as a curiosity about outdoor experiences has evolved into a hospitality‑driven venture focused on connection, comfort, and intentional design. Off Map isn’t just a place to stay; it’s an environment built to slow people down and bring them closer to nature, to each other, and to themselves. This week’s episode explores how Ryan’s philosophy has shaped his leadership, his entrepreneurial approach, and his understanding of what modern guests truly value. As consumers increasingly seek experiences that feel meaningful rather than transactional, Ryan’s perspective offers a blueprint for where hospitality is heading.     100th Episode Special: Chef Ivy Stark, City Harvest, and the Fight to Feed New York

    It's official. Culinary Confidential has hit 100 episodes! And to celebrate this landmark episode, Christina Cates turns to a cause with a lasting impact across the five boroughs of New York City: the battle against hunger. To discuss this battle against hunger, Christina welcomes chef, restauranteur, and cookbook author Ivy Stark - a recognized force in Mexican cuisine and a dedicated member of City Harvest's food council. Stark has spent her career elevating Mexican flavors while championing thoughtful, ingredient-driven cooking. After earning a history degree from UCLA and training at the Institute of Culinary Education, she cut her teeth at Border Grill under Mary Sue Milliken and Susan Feniger. She went on to hold executive chef and corporate roles at Zócalo, Rosa Mexicano, and Dos Caminos, helping define upscale Mexican dining in New York for over a decade. Today she channels that expertise into plant-forward, health-conscious Mexican cuisine through Ivy Stark MEXology and BKLYN Wild at Time Out Market New York. A three-time cookbook author, Stark brings both culinary authority and a deep personal commitment to the table. As a member of City Harvest’s Food Council, she helps guide efforts to rescue surplus food and deliver it to New Yorkers who need it most, operating on the simple but powerful principle that City Harvest has championed for over four decades: that perfectly good food should never go to waste while New Yorkers go hungry. The organization rescues surplus food from restaurants, grocers, manufacturers, and farms, then delivers it to community programs across the city. Right now, the need is urgent. Over 1.4 million New Yorkers face food insecurity, including one in every four children. In a city celebrated for its restaurants and culinary innovation, these numbers are a stark reminder of the gap between abundance and access. City Harvest's work bridges that gap, turning potential waste into real meals, dignity, and hope. Some shows chase trends. Culinary Confidential follows the people and pressures that shape them. In this 100th episode, Christina and Ivy explore the human side of that mission: the logistics of large-scale food rescue, the role chefs and restaurants can play, and the daily realities faced by families who rely on these programs.     Extra Virgin Olive Oil: Why Is It Liquid Gold?

    What does it really mean to rethink of the ways we renourish ourselves? On this week's Culinary Confidential, Christina Cates welcomes Susan Julia - olive oil sommelier, educator, wellness advocate, and one of the most passionate voices championing the power of exceptional extra virgin olive oil. While most people think of olive oil as an ingredient, Susan sees it as a living, breathing expression of culture, agriculture, and health. In this conversation, she explains why truly premium olive oil deserves the same respect we give fine wine - its terroir, its craftsmanship, its chemistry, and its ability to elevate both flavor and wellbeing. As America continues rediscovering the value of real food and intentional living, this episode explores the principles that have defined the Mediterranean lifestyle for centuries: slowing down, cooking with purpose, eating with community, moving daily, and choosing ingredients that support longevity. We’ll talk about polyphenols, heart‑healthy fats, anti‑inflammatory benefits, and why one bottle of exceptional olive oil can transform your kitchen, your wellness routine, and even your skincare. This is more than a conversation about cooking. It’s about living deliberately, honoring tradition, and understanding how one ancient ingredient can still teach us how to care for ourselves today.     Americana 250: Patriots Meet Cowboys!

    For Week Three of Culinary Confidential's Americana 250 series, patriots meet cowboys! Not the football teams but rather, two icons who embody patriotism, resilience, and heritage in their own powerful ways! Scott LoBaido is a renowned American artist, activist, and creative patriot best known for his powerful paintings and murals of the U.S. flag. Born in Staten Island, LoBaido has spent 30+ years painting thousands of renditions of Old Glory on schools, firehouses, police stations, homes, and public buildings across all 50 states. His work honors veterans, first responders, and the American spirit, often dedicated to those who serve. A vocal advocate for patriotism and national unity, LoBaido’s art blends creativity with activism, turning public spaces into bold celebrations of freedom and pride. Kent Rollins is a legendary chuckwagon cook, cowboy, bestselling author, and storyteller from Oklahoma. With over 34 years of experience cooking outdoors over live fire for ranches across America, he preserves the authentic traditions of the Old West. Raised around cattle and ranching, Kent bought his first chuckwagon in 1993 and has since become a beloved figure through his YouTube channel, cookbooks, and appearances on Food Network shows like Chopped Grill Masters and Beat Bobby Flay. He travels the country alongside his wife Shannon to share hearty recipes, frontier wisdom, and the camaraderie of cowboy life from their cast-iron skillet. From bold strokes of red, white, and blue to the sizzle of cast-iron skillets over open flames, this conversation dives into the people, places, and traditions that continue defining our nation.  And it's more than just flags and food. This conversation is all about patriotism in practice, heritage with heart, and the shared values that bind us: pride, perseverance, community, and the joy of serving something bigger than ourselves.
